What are the subclasses of immunoglobulin A (IgA)?

Posted July 31, 2024


Answer

There are two subclasses of Immunoglobulin A (IgA) in humans – IgA1 and IgA2. These subclasses differ in the molecular mass of their heavy chains, structure of their hinge region, and concentration in serum.
